Description | ObjectivesParticipants will be able to apply the R tidyverse, a powerful collection of R packages for data science, to analyse their own data sets. Particularly, there are going to learn:
ContentThis two-day course for intermediate R users focuses on the tidyverse, a collection of R packages for data science. We are going to focus on the two key packages dplyr ("The grammar of graphics") and ggplot2 ("The grammar of graphics") plus several more such as purrr (enhanced functional programming), tidyr (helpers to create tidy data sets), readr (fast & friendly data import/export), tibble (modern data frames), lubridate (easy and fast parsing of date-times) and forcats (tools for working with categorial variables). The course is a mixture between brief presentations, demonstrations (on-screen, using R and RStudio) and supervised exercises ("learning by doing").
